Today, on behalf of Biggani.org, we spoke with Bangladesh’s renowned scientist Dr. Rashed Islam. He is primarily a materials scientist and reliability physicist. In this conversation, he shared his deep passion for research, success stories, and valuable advice for young researchers.
The Start of Research: Emergence of Interest from Materials Engineering
Dr. Rashed Islam began his academic journey at Bangladesh University of Engineering and Technology (BUET), where he earned his bachelor’s degree in Metallurgical Engineering. During his undergraduate studies, he became deeply fascinated by the properties of metals. He specifically noticed that changes in the amount of carbon and other elements in iron lead to significant differences in its qualities. For example, increasing the carbon content in steel makes it stronger but more brittle, whereas low-carbon steel is more ductile. These kinds of material science concepts paved the way for his interest in research.
The Concept of Research: The Pursuit of Discovery
Dr. Islam believes that research means seeking anew, that is, “re-search.” According to him, the main goal of a researcher is to add something new to the world’s body of knowledge. This realization inspired him to begin his journey as a researcher.

First Steps: Research at City University of Hong Kong
For postgraduate studies, he applied to study in the United States but could not go due to visa complications. However, he did not stop there. He used that time to complete his master’s degree at BUET and later began research at the City University of Hong Kong. There, he worked on electronic packaging technology, which helps improve the reliability of the main logic board. This technology is vital in modern electronics, as it enhances microchip reliability.
In Hong Kong, working under a renowned scientist, he learned the methods of research and the art of securing research funding. He realized that obtaining funding is a crucial skill for any researcher.
Research in the United States: PhD and New Technologies
Later, he enrolled in the PhD program at the University of Texas at Arlington in the United States. There, he worked on piezoelectric technology, which generates electricity on a micro scale through mechanical stress. Using this technology, he developed magnetic sensors that help detect buried mines for the defense industry. At the time, there were very few researchers in this field, which motivated him to pursue it further.
He says that considering the impact of research is crucial. Finding new topics and asking the right questions are keys to success in research.
Electronic Packaging and Reliability
Dr. Islam has worked on electronic packaging, where electronic circuits or boards are packaged in such a way that they are reliable and long-lasting. Reliability engineering is a field focused on extending a product’s service life and reducing failure rates. Studies have shown that about 30% of electronic device failures stem from packaging problems. Proper packaging protects devices from external environments and enhances their performance.

Sustainability and Recycling Plastic
He later became interested in sustainability and worked on the reliability of recycled plastic. Plastic waste is a major global issue, with about 380 million tons produced yearly, but only 9% is recycled. He is researching how to optimize the process of recycling so that the quality and strength of recycled plastic remain intact and last longer.
Future Plans: Plastics from Natural Sources
Dr. Islam is currently working on the reliability of bioplastics and how to make them biodegradable. Biodegradable plastic is better for the environment, as it naturally decomposes in soil and reduces pollution. For example, plastics made from corn starch or cellulose are biodegradable and recyclable.

Advice for Young Researchers
He says that not everyone has to become a researcher. But those who want to must first discover their true motivation. Knowing the answer to “why” is very important. To find this answer, one must read extensively and learn about current research fields. Reading and analyzing research papers is essential for young researchers.
Patience and Perseverance: Keys to Success
Patience and perseverance are very important in research. He says that during the first two years of his PhD, he had no results and felt frustrated. But his supervisor encouraged him to keep going. Eventually, he completed his PhD successfully. In his view, a researcher must work with great patience and perseverance.
